Which Services Are Available Around the Clock?
Jump starts, fuel delivery, tire changes, lockout assistance, winch-out recovery, and full vehicle towing operate 24/7 throughout the service area.
Dead batteries, empty fuel tanks, flat tires, and locked keys represent the most common roadside emergencies. Professional operators arrive equipped to handle these issues on-site, often getting you back on the road without needing a tow. Jump start services use proper equipment to safely restart most vehicles, while fuel delivery brings gasoline directly to your location, eliminating the need to walk to a station.
Tire change assistance helps drivers replace flat tires with their spare, and lockout service provides access to vehicles when keys are locked inside. Winch-out recovery uses specialized equipment to extract vehicles stuck in mud, ditches, or snow, preventing further damage during the extraction process. Full vehicle towing remains available for situations where on-site repairs are not possible, transporting cars, trucks, motorcycles, and commercial vehicles to repair facilities or storage locations.

Do Response Times Vary by Time of Day?
Dispatch teams prioritize calls based on safety hazards and location, maintaining consistent response standards regardless of the hour.
High-traffic periods during morning and evening commutes may see increased call volume, but continuous monitoring and strategic truck positioning help maintain prompt response times. Nighttime calls often receive faster service due to reduced traffic congestion, allowing towing operators to reach breakdown sites more quickly. Weekend and holiday coverage remains fully staffed, ensuring no reduction in service quality during periods when traditional businesses close.
Operators assess each call for safety hazards such as vehicles blocking lanes, leaking fluids, or drivers stranded in extreme weather. These high-priority situations receive immediate dispatch, while lower-risk calls are handled in order of receipt. This system ensures that the most dangerous situations receive the fastest response, protecting both stranded drivers and passing traffic.
